Performance


  • < 1.3 mm spatial resolution for all PET isotopes
  • Down to 5 sec frames for whole body scans
  • Low activities < 1MBq can be easily imaged
  • Suitable for Radio-TLC and organ ex vivo imaging
  • Suitable for targeted-radionuclide-therapy studies
  • 5 % sensitivity at the center of the Field-Of-View
  • Time activity curves ready at the end of the acquisition
  • Automated decay correction

True Benchtop Imaging


β-eye

Turn your desk into a lab

  • Footprint of 44 cm (L) x 46 cm (W) x 40 cm (H)
  • Weight < 40 kg
  • USB 3.0 and Gb Ethernet connectivity
  • Minimum installation requirements
  • Versatile transportation
  • Delivered in a protective, easily-transportable suitcase
